- If being swapped into a Cali car, the engine must have originally been a Cali certified engine.
- Must be from the same class of car. This refers to "light duty trucks" and whatnot. Any engine from a CAR can go into any other CAR, but no Ford Super Duty or GM HD engines into cars (as if they would fit).
- Even after a "legal" swap, the car must be inspected and certified by a smog referee.
